I can reproduce the bug through these steps: 1. Copy a piece of text in Netbeans 2. Paste the text in an applicaiton 3. In From this application copy some other text 4. Paste the text into netbeans 5. Paste it somewhere 6. Copy text again 7. Every new copy from netbeans from now on will not work anymore. If I do not copy in an outside application the clipboard will now be empty (and not the text from step 6 anymore) I tested these steps with Notpad++, Firefox and the windows file explorer and have the same result exactly after these steps. Also if I mix applications in between. I checked the logs but no error was reported. I am running Netbeans 13 on Windows 10.0 on amd64 with Oracle JDK 17 (17+35-LTS-2724) but had the same issue on older JDKs.
